    Eh, I don’t think purple prose is the word you’re looking for as it certainly is NOT what Paolini stole from Tolkien. Paolini is very much purple prose and has a habit of using really odd metaphors, describing in insane detail and completely in appropriate times (battles), thesaurus abuse, inappropriate use of words, and in general there is no art to his descriptions.

    Tolkien is descriptive. Descriptive in a way that modern sensibility dislikes, but it is not wrong per say. The standards have changed on what constitutes good writing as have people’s patience for slow paced stories (for movies, compare the pace of Lawrence of Arabia to any historical fiction piece today.) What Tolkien does is paint a picture with words and not at in appropriate times like Paolini. It’s one of things that I enjoy about Tolkien, although many do not appreciate, is the ability to visualize in specific detail these different places in his world. But it’s not purple. The physical descriptions of his characters are pretty sparse which is often a tip-off for purple prose/ description at the wrong time. Furthermore, I would argue his word choice is very deliberate and conscious not only to it’s meaning, but its historical roots (no anachronistic words here).

    Puppet, there is a lot of work that goes into deciding the topics, getting the right people with the most to say (and making sure that I include new people who want to do this and that the group I choose all have a fair amount to say on the two chosen topics), making sure they’re all ready to go, and co-ordinating a time and date to Skype that will work for people spread across 16 time zones and who have varying schedules in the week. And that’s all before we even start talking.

    Currently, I’m waiting for the transcript of the second episode and have just settled on the right combination of topics and people for episode 3. We are now working on getting the right time together. I wanted to record it this week, but we have some clashing dates, and since I’m no longer working casual hours, my schedule is not as accomodating as it was last year. It has to be recorded around a weekend, so that pushes recording date back at least another five days. And communication itself is a slow process, as we all have internet access at different times of day, even if some people are in the same time zone.

    It’ll happen, but it’s slow going, and with a different cast for every episode the time taken will vary by a lot of factors depending on the people involved, their schedules, and any technical problems (eg malfunctioning microphones, computer or recording problems, etc). Just a fact.

    Please trust that I am actually working on this, that I know what I’m doing, and if I don’t I will ask for help and try to correct stuff as quickly as possible. I thinkg about this thing at least five times a day. It’s not languishing on a backburner. This process will get faster because I’m learning as I’m going, am still learning to push through the lack of momentum that sometimes happens due to the above factors, and only have one episode on the go at a time. But even once I get a good flow going and start editing an old one and organising a new one at the same time this process will never be instantaneous. I’ve been doing this kind of thing for over a year, and let me tell you, the amount of work that goes into co-ordinating, shooting and editing a clear and concise five-minute information video every single week is a lot, but if it’s localised it can be done in a week. This by comparison, is nowhere near as small. It has several components and relies on the co-operation of people across the globe, not within a four-to-five kilometre radius. It cannot be done in a week, every week.

    Finally, Episode 2 will be published when it is publishable. At the moment it isn’t, because it’s missing a transcript (no pressure on Thea). We need to consider that we have at least two hearing-impaired regular members and it’s not fair to bring out something that isn’t accessible to them and it has the added factor of making everything we’ve said searchable and more easily accessible. I know it has been a while since it was last mentioned here, but consider that it has been delayed nearly a month because I had no internet access and so no way to upload the final edit, which I did on the second and third days of my holiday.
